Integrate Oracle SSO with third party SSO Server

  Oracle’s Single Sign-On Server was part of Oracle Application Server till version 10.1.2.0.2 Oracle SSO now is part of Oracle Identity Management (10.1.4) which is part of Oracle Fusion Middleware family. Various third party Access Management solution which you can integrate with Oracle SSO Server are Netegrity Site Minder, Oblix COREid (now Oracle Access Manager), […]

Upgrade Oracle Applications to 11.5.10.2

Here is quick post on document/notes you should refer to upgrade your Oracle Applications to version 11.5.10.2  1. Upgrade of Oracle Application to 11.5.10.2 from previous release of 11i (11.5.5 to 11.5.9)  should be done by applying maintenance pack i.e. Patch # 3480000 and few other prereq. & post patch steps.
